A chelating agent is a substance that can form multiple bonds to a single metal ion, effectively binding it in a stable complex. Chelating agents are ligands that are able to form two or more coordinate covalent bonds with a metal ion. Chelating agents are chemical compounds whose structures permit the attachment of their two or more donor atoms (or sites) to the same metal ion.
